The newly established research group on Natural Language Processing at
the Department of Mathematics and Computer Science at the University
of Marburg (Germany) is seeking applications for a position as
Doctoral Researcher in one of the research areas of the group, which
include: Methods and Applications of Natural Language Processing,
Perspectivism and Disagreement in NLP, AI for Social Good, Legal Tech
and NLP Evaluation.
The position is offered for a period of 3 years. he position is
fulltime with salary and benefits commensurate with a public service
position in the state Hesse, Germany (TV-H E 13).
Tasks:
- scientific services in research and teaching
- conduct independent research within the interest areas of the group
- design, develop, and evaluate NLP models and systems with experts
from application domains
- help shaping the research agenda of the group
- publish results in top-tier academic conferences and journals
The position is limited to a time period deemed adequate for the
completion of a doctoral degree. As part of the assigned duties, there
will be ample opportunity to conduct the independent scientific
research necessary for the completion of a doctorate.
Profile:
- MSc-degree or equivalent in Computer Science, Computational
Linguistics or a related field
- experience in Natural Language Processing and programming
- interest in real-world applications of Natural Language Processing
- ability to work independently as well as in interdisciplinary teams
in an international environment
- excellent communication skills in English, the ability to
communicate in German is beneficial
Disposition to own scientific qualification is expected. We actively
support the professional development of junior researchers by the
offers of Marburg Research Academy (MARA), the International Office
and the Higher Education Didactics Office.
We offer:
- fulltime position with renumeration according to TV Hesse
- support in establishing your own scientific profile
- national and international collaboration opportunities
- access to HPC facilities
